MOBILE, Ala. – The University of South Alabama Department of Athletics has announced plans to pursue external funding in order to construct a cutting-edge practice facility for the men's and women's golf programs.
The facility — which will be constructed at the west end of the driving range at the Robert Trent Jones Magnolia Grove Golf Course — is set to include a 2,000-square-foot house featuring two hitting bays equipped with golf swing analysis cameras as well as men's and women's locker rooms.  The complex will feature a short-game area containing chipping greens, putting greens and a bunker as well.
In addition to providing opportunities to improve for student-athletes in the two programs the complex is expected to aid in future recruiting.
